ABSTRACT:
A hitch assembly is provided having a hitch shank configured to be received within an opening of a hitch receiver of a tow vehicle and a wedge member disposed about the hitch shank. The wedge member has first and second surfaces on opposing sides of the wedge member, angled relative to one another. An engagement device is coupled to the wedge member to press the wedge member to an engaged position that causes the hitch shank to bias away from the receiver tube to minimize play therebetween.
